The invention discloses an energy-saving hydraulic system for a telescopic boom of an electric reach stacker. An inlet and an outlet of a constant displacement pump/motor are connected with two cavities of a telescopic boom oil cylinder through a second switch valve and a third switch valve respectively; outlets of two safety valves are connected; inlets of the two safety valves are respectively connected with the inlet and the outlet of the constant displacement pump/motor; forward inlets of two hydraulic control one-way valves are connected; outlets of the two hydraulic control one-way valves are connected with the inlet and the outlet of the constant displacement pump/motor respectively; a hydraulic control port of the first hydraulic control one-way valve is connected with an outlet of the second hydraulic control one-way valve; a hydraulic control port of the second hydraulic control one-way valve is connected with an outlet of the first hydraulic control one-way valve; the outlets of the safety valves, the forward inlets of the hydraulic control one-way valves and the oil tank are connected; and an inlet of the second safety valve is connected with the oil tank through a first switch valve. The energy-saving hydraulic system for the telescopic boom of the electric reach stacker solves the problem that the telescopic boom of the pure electric reach stacker can not only passively retract and recover energy under the conditions of heavy load and large angle, but also actively retract under the conditions of light load and small angle.
